Zwinne metody pracy przyniosły tak wiele ról: Agile Delivery Lead, Agile Delivery Manager, Scrum Master. Które z tych ról są takie same, a które inne? A jeśli się różnią, jaka jest między nimi różnica? Wyjaśnijmy zamieszanie wokół ról w Agile!😎
Wyjaśnienie wszystkich ról zwinnego dostarczania
Czym są role zwinnego dostarczania?
Agile Delivery Roles to role zaangażowane w dostarczanie wartości klientom i interesariuszom przy użyciu zwinnych metod i praktyk. W większości przypadków role te są oparte na proponowanych Role w Scrumie:
👩🏽🏫Scrum Master: Osoba, która ułatwia proces Scrum i pomaga zespołowi przestrzegać wartości, zasad i praktyk Scrum.
🗣Właściciel produktu: Osoba, która reprezentuje głos klienta i interesariuszy oraz jest odpowiedzialna za definiowanie i ustalanie priorytetów zaległości produktowych.
👨🏽🔬Zespół ds. rozwoju Grupa ludzi, którzy pracują razem, aby dostarczyć potencjalnie dostarczalne przyrosty produktu lub usługi.
Role te mogą być jednak mieszane z innymi rolami z różnych zwinnych frameworków, takich jak np. SAFe (Scaled Agile Framework):
🚄Zwolnij maszynistę pociągu: Osoba, która ułatwia i prowadzi Agile Release Train (ART), tj. grupę zespołów dostarczających wartość w przyrostach programu.
💻Architekt/inżynier systemów: Osoba, która definiuje wizję techniczną i architekturę systemu lub rozwiązania dostarczanego przez ART.
⭕Właściciel firmy: Osoba reprezentująca interesy biznesowe i potrzeby związane z systemem lub rozwiązaniem dostarczanym przez ART.
Lub również w Model Spotify:
👩🏽💼Lider grupy: Osoba, która przewodzi i zapewnia wskazówki oraz wsparcie grupie osób o podobnych umiejętnościach lub kompetencjach, takich jak programiści, testerzy, projektanci itp.
🤹🏽♀️Squad Lead: Osoba, która kieruje wielofunkcyjnym zespołem zapewniającym wytyczne i wsparcie dla określonej funkcji lub obszaru produktu.
🤵🏽Tribe drabina: Osoba, która kieruje grupą zespołów pracujących nad powiązanymi funkcjami lub obszarami produktów oraz zapewnia im strategiczny kierunek i koordynację.
Oprócz tych ról specyficznych dla frameworka, oczywiście często widzimy "Agile Coachów" szkolących Scrum Masterów i inne role.
Zanim przejdziemy dalej: Jeśli jesteś nowym menedżerem, polecam obejrzenie mojego wideo z 7 typowymi błędami popełnianymi przez menedżerów, których zdecydowanie powinieneś unikać.
Wyjaśnienie wszystkich ról zwinnego dostarczania
Agile Delivery Manager vs Scrum Master
Jednym z najczęstszych pytań pojawiających się w związku z rolą Agile Delivery Managera jest: "Jaka jest różnica między Agile Delivery Managerem a Scrum Masterem? Czy są one takie same czy różne? A jeśli się różnią, to jaka jest między nimi różnica?".
Odpowiedź nie jest prosta, ponieważ różne organizacje mogą mieć różne definicje i oczekiwania dotyczące tych ról. Poniżej znajdziesz jednak ogólne porównanie oparte na pewnych wspólnych aspektach:
Czym w ogóle jest Agile Delivery Manager?
Menedżer ds. realizacji Agile to osoba, która kieruje zespołami ds. realizacji Agile i zapewnia, że mogą one dostarczać wartość klientom i interesariuszom. Są nie tylko trenerami lub facylitatorami, ale także odpowiadają za proces dostarczania i wyniki.
Są oni odpowiedzialni za zapewnienie, że zespoły postępują zgodnie z zasadami i praktykami agile, jednocześnie dostosowując się do zmieniających się potrzeb i oczekiwań biznesu i użytkowników.
Niektórzy z nich Główne zadania są:
📝Planowanie i ustalanie priorytetów
🎤Coaching i mentoring
🗣Umiarkowanie i komunikacja
🦸♀️Usuwanie przeszkód i rozwiązywanie problemów
⏱Pomiar i doskonalenie
Różnice między Scrum Masterem a Agile Delivery Leadem:
Scrum Master | Agile Delivery Lead | |
---|---|---|
Odpowiedzialność: | Ciągłe doskonalenie Scrum | Odpowiedzialność za ukończenie |
Działania: | Coaching i moderacja | Coaching i moderacja |
Zakres: | Zespół lub projekt | Wiele zespołów i projektów |
Ramy: | Scrum | Wszystkie zwinne frameworki |
Skup się: | Wydajność zespołu i procesy | Wartość dodana i wyniki |
Jak widać z powyższej tabeli, istnieją pewne podobieństwa i różnice między Agile Delivery Managerem a Scrum Masterem. Obie role obejmują działania coachingowe i facylitacyjne, ale mają różne obowiązki, działania, inną sferę wpływów, używają różnych ram i koncentrują się na innych wynikach.
Krótka informacja, niezależnie od tego, jaką rolę pełnisz lub będziesz pełnić: Zarządzanie programistami podczas regularnych spotkań jeden na jeden jest absolutnie kluczowe. Widać to wyraźnie na powyższej grafice. Są to Twoje najważniejsze spotkania jako agile managera. Czy zdajesz sobie z tego sprawę?
W każdym razie chciałbym zwrócić twoją uwagę na nasze darmowe oprogramowanie do spotkań 1:1, które zostało opracowane specjalnie dla zwinnych zespołów. Spraw, aby Twoje spotkania 1:1 były ekscytujące, mierz trendy, a przede wszystkim rób postępy w rozwoju swoich pracowników! Wypróbuj jeden z naszych szablonów, patrz poniżej.
Bez zbędnej gadaniny, bez niezręcznych przerw. Ten szablon 1:1 po prostu zawsze działa.
- Z jakiego osiągnięcia jesteś dumny, a którego mogłem nie zauważyć?
- Jaka drobna zmiana natychmiast usprawniłaby twoją pracę?
- Na co chciałbyś poświęcić więcej czasu w pracy?
...
Wyjaśnienie wszystkich ról zwinnego dostarczania
Agile Delivery Lead vs Scrum Master⚔
Innym często zadawanym pytaniem dotyczącym roli Agile Delivery jest: Jaka jest różnica między Agile Delivery Lead a Scrum Masterem? Czy to ta sama rola, czy różne role? A jeśli są różne, jaka jest między nimi różnica?
Odpowiedź brzmi: są różne role.
Agile Delivery Lead jest czymś w rodzaju "Head of Scrum Masters" lub "Chief Scrum Master" w nowym sformułowaniu. Jest on odpowiedzialny za prowadzenie i zarządzanie wieloma zwinnymi zespołami lub projektami w ramach organizacji lub programu.
Są oni również odpowiedzialni za dostosowanie wizji i celów organizacji lub programu do zespołów lub projektów, którymi kierują. Zajmują się również coachingiem i mentoringiem innych zwinnych ról, takich jak agile delivery managerowie czy scrum masterzy.
Niektórzy z nich Główne zadania są:
🤵🏽Prowadzić i kierować
🎤Coaching i mentoring
🗣Umiarkowanie i komunikacja
🦸♀️Usuwanie przeszkód i rozwiązywanie problemów
⏱Pomiar i doskonalenie
The Różnica między Agile Delivery Lead a Scrum Masterem polega zatem głównie na Zakres i odpowiedzialność.
Agile Delivery Lead pracuje na wyższym poziomie i nadzoruje wiele zespołów lub projektów, podczas gdy Scrum Master pracuje na niższym poziomie i koncentruje się na jednym zespole lub projekcie.
Agile Delivery Lead ma również większy autorytet i wpływ na organizację lub program, podczas gdy Scrum Master ma większą autonomię i autorytet w zespole.
Agile Delivery Lead może mieć również większe doświadczenie i wiedzę specjalistyczną w zakresie zwinnego dostarczania, podczas gdy Scrum Master ma większą wiedzę i umiejętności w zakresie Scrum.
Jeśli chcesz dowiedzieć się więcej o tym, czym zajmuje się Agile Delivery Manager/Lead, przeczytaj nasz artykuł:
👉🏽Agile Delivery 1×1
Jak zostać Delivery Managerem Agile? 👩🏽🎓
Jeśli chcesz zostać kierownikiem ds. zwinnego dostarczania, musisz dokonać dwóch kluczowych zmian w swoim sposobie myślenia i podejściu do zwinnego dostarczania:
- Zaakceptuj, że Scrum nie jest jedynym właściwym rozwiązaniem do pracy zwinnej.
- Zaakceptuj, że jesteś nie tylko trenerem lub facylitatorem, ale także właścicielem procesu dostarczania i wyników.
Oczywiście zmiany te nie są łatwe ani szybkie. Możesz potrzebować szkolenia, mentoringu lub coachingu, aby zdobyć umiejętności i wiedzę potrzebne do zostania zwinnym menedżerem ds. dostarczania.
Możesz także potrzebować doświadczenia w świecie rzeczywistym, aby uczyć się na własnych sukcesach i porażkach oraz uzyskać informacje zwrotne od współpracowników i przełożonych.
Perspektywy: Przyszłość nazywa się "Agile Delivery Manager", bye bye Scrum Master👋🏽
"Agile Delivery Managers" to zwinny trend w 2023 roku, ponieważ stopy procentowe rosną, a wiele firm nie chce już pozwolić sobie na Scrum Mastera, który często staje się bardziej "trenerem zespołu / menedżerem dobrego samopoczucia".
Zamiast tego firmy chcą wiedzieć, że cały ich budżet jest przeznaczany na rzeczywiste wdrożenie, na ludzi, którzy są odpowiedzialni za wyniki.
Wyższe kierownictwo będzie miało znacznie mniej problemów z posiadaniem na liście płac "Agile Delivery Managerów" niż tajemniczych "Scrum Masterów", którzy odmawiają wzięcia odpowiedzialności za wyniki zespołu.
Zobaczymy, jak ta zmiana rozwinie się w ciągu najbliższych kilku lat. Miejmy nadzieję, że ta zmiana będzie korzystna zarówno dla zespołów, jak i klientów.
To wszystko, co mam w tej chwili. Mam nadzieję, że ten artykuł pomógł Ci dowiedzieć się więcej o rolach w zwinnym rozwoju, zwłaszcza o różnicy między Agile Delivery Managerem a Scrum Masterem. Jeśli masz jakieś pytania lub uwagi, daj mi znać 😊.
Większość trenerów Agile kręci się w kółko....
i leczyć powierzchowne objawy. Nadszedł czas, aby wykorzystać psychologię – do trwałej zmiany sposobu myślenia.